GARGAZON - GARGAZZONE

Region: Trentino-Alto Adige
Province : Bolzano

Stemma di Gargazon
Official blazon
Italian
  • (de) In Silber auf rotem Berg ein natürlicher, unbegiebelter Turm.
  • (it) D'argento alla torre senza cuspide al naturale fondata su montagna di rosso.
English blazon wanted

Origin/meaning

The arms were granted on February 28, 1968.

The arms show the castle Kröllturm (nowadays only a ruin), built in 1240 by Bartold von Trautson. The three trees symbolise the fruit trees in the area.
